Upkeep Tips for Stamped Concrete
Normal maintenance is important for protecting the charm and long life of stamped concrete patios. Homeowners should see this here routinely cleanse the surface area utilizing a soft-bristle broom and a moderate detergent to eliminate dirt and debris. It is recommended to prevent severe chemicals, as they can harm the finish. Sealing the concrete every 2 to 3 years helps secure it from wetness and stains, ensuring the dynamic colors continue to be undamaged.
Furthermore, property owners ought to examine the patio area for cracks or damage regularly. Trigger repair work can avoid additional deterioration. Throughout winter season, shoveling snow carefully and utilizing a plastic shovel can prevent scraping the surface area. It is additionally crucial to avoid using de-icing salts, as they might hurt the concrete. Exactly How Long Does Stamped Concrete Last Contrasted to Normal Concrete?
Stamped concrete typically lasts 25 to three decades, typically outlasting regular concrete, which generally sustains 20 to 25 years. Factors such as maintenance, installation, and climate quality can affect the longevity of both kinds.
Can I Set Up Stamped Concrete Over Existing Concrete Surfaces?
Yes, stamped concrete can be mounted over existing concrete surfaces, offered the original concrete is in good problem. Proper preparation, including cleansing and fixing splits, is essential for guaranteeing a long-term and successful installation.
Is Stamped Concrete Safe for Swimming Pool Areas?
When appropriately mounted, stamped concrete is typically safe for swimming pool locations. Its textured surface area improves slip resistance, minimizing the risk of accidents - concrete contractor near mesa. Normal maintenance is vital to assure security and longevity of the setup.
What Is the Expense Difference In Between Stamped and Standard Concrete?
The price distinction in between traditional and stamped concrete typically varies from $2 to $5 per square foot. Stamped concrete is usually a why not try these out lot more costly due to its complex patterns and additional labor needed for installation.
Just How Does Weather Impact the Installation of Stamped Concrete?
Weather condition substantially influences stamped concrete installation. High humidity can postpone curing, while extreme temperature levels may cause fracturing. Ideal problems include moderate temperature levels and reduced moisture, making sure finest bond and coating for the ornamental surface.
